Le village 3 est un établissement de type restaurant, situé à Pont-de-Metz. Cet établissement est noté 3,3/5 sur 12 avis et propose Drive, Livraison, Retrait en bordure de trottoir, Vente à emporter, Sur place et Livraison sans contact.
